What is rule type in SAP CA-FS-PO - Price Optimization for Banking?


SAP Term: rule type

  • Component: CA-FS-PO

  • Component Name: Price Optimization for Banking

  • Description: The type of linear constraints imposed by the associated segment rules on pricing segments. For example, None means it is independent of constraints, Ignore means this pricing segment is disregarded, and Pricing means that is follows the rules set in the UI.
